The South African Broadcasting Corporation (SABC) has confirmed it no longer employs officials for door-to-door TV licence inspections, raising concerns about fraudulent impersonators targeting households. The broadcaster warns the public to verify inspectors' credentials to avoid scams. This follows confusion over the legitimacy of inspection visits.
The SABC says it currently has no officials conducting door-to-door TV licence inspections, while warning households about people impersonating inspectors.
